California Evidence Code

§ 210

EVID § 210Div. 2
“Relevant evidence” means evidence, including evidence relevant to the credibility of a witness or hearsay declarant, having any tendency in reason to prove or disprove any disputed fact that is of consequence to the determination of the action.

Legislative history

Enacted by Stats. 1965, Ch. 299.
